Ingredients for Cookie Dough Overnight Oats
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ious Cookie Dough Overnight Oats:
1/2 cup rolled oats – The base of our recipe; quick-cooking or old-fashioned oats work beautifully to achieve that creamy texture.
2 tablespoons vanilla protein powder – Adds a protein punch, making these oats filling enough to power you through your morning.
1/2 cup milk of choice – Use dairy or plant-based milk like almond or oat for a creamy consistency.
1 tablespoon sweetener of choice – Honey, maple syrup, or your preferred sweetener will balance the flavors beautifully.
2 tablespoons plain or Greek yogurt – Gives the oats a tangy kick while also boosting the creaminess.
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ract – Like adding a warm hug of flavor, this makes every bite taste more delightful.
1 tablespoon almond butter – Rich, nutty, and delicious; it adds healthy fats and a cookie-dough-like vibe.
Chocolate chips – Because who can resist the allure of chocolate? These add the quintessential cookie dough flavor.
How to Make Cookie Dough Overnight Oats
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Cookie Dough Overnight Oats:
Step 1: Gather Your Ingredients
To kick things off, collect all your ingredients for the Cookie Dough Overnight Oats. This not only ensures you won’t forget anything but also makes the whole process smoother.
Step 2: Combine the Dry Ingredients
In a bowl or a mason jar, mix together the rolled oats and vanilla protein powder. Get those dry ingredients cozy together; this is where the magic begins.
Step 3: Add the Wet Ingredients
Pour in the milk, and add the sweetener, yogurt, vanilla extract, and almond butter. Whisk, stir, or shake it all up until it looks like a creamy concoction that you might just want to dive into right away.
Step 4: Chocolatey Goodness
Now it’s time for the chocolate chips! Add them to the mixture and fold them in gently. This is crucial; we don’t want any chip casualties here.
Step 5: Chill Out
Cover your bowl or jar with a lid or plastic wrap, and pop it into the fridge. Let it chill overnight—yes, it’s tempting to dig in immediately—but the flavors will meld beautifully while you dream about how amazing breakfast will be.
Step 6: The Grand Finale
In the morning, awaken your taste buds by adding a little extra almond butter and a handful of chocolate chips on top. This is where you present your tasty masterpiece—enjoy it straight from the jar or transfer to a delightful bowl if you’re feeling fancy!

Storing & Reheating Cookie Dough Overnight Oats
Store your Cookie Dough Overnight Oats in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. If reheating, microwave in short bursts, stirring between intervals to maintain an even temperature without compromising texture.

Can I make Cookie Dough Overnight Oats ahead of time?
Absolutely! Cookie Dough Overnight Oats are designed for meal prep. You can prepare them in advance and store them in the fridge for up to three days. The oats will soften as they absorb the milk and yogurt overnight, creating a creamy texture that’s ready for you when you wake up. Just remember to keep the additional toppings, like chocolate chips or almond butter, separate until you’re ready to eat for the best experience.
